Imbalance, or malocclusion, is one of the most common factor individuals see an orthodontist. It is hereditary and is the result of dimension differences between the upper and lower jaw or in between the jaw and teeth. Malocclusion results in tooth congestion, an askew jaw, or irregular bite patterns. Malocclusion is usually treated with: Your orthodontist connects steel, ceramic, or plastic square bonds to your teeth.


If you have only minor malocclusion, you might be able to utilize clear braces, called aligners, instead of conventional braces (https://disqus.com/by/legacyortho/about/). Some individuals need a headgear to help relocate teeth into line with stress from outside the mouth. After braces or aligners, you'll require to put on a retainer. go to this web-site A retainer is a customized device that maintains your teeth in position.

If you have a severe underbite or overbite, you might need orthognathic surgical procedure (likewise called orthodontic surgery) to lengthen or shorten your jaw. Orthodontists utilize cords, surgical screws, or plates to sustain your jaw bone.


You might need to see an orthodontist if you have: Crowding or not adequate room for every one of your teethOverbite, when your upper teeth come your base teethUnderbite, when your base teeth are too much forwardSpacing or concerns with gapsCrossbite, which is when your top teeth fit behind your bottom teeth when your mouth is closedOpen bite or a vertical space between your front bottom and upper teethMisplaced midline, when the center of your base and top teeth do not align Dealing with a dental malocclusion can: Make biting, eating, and talking easierImprove the proportion of our face and your total appearanceEase pain from temporomandibular joint disordersDifferent your teeth and make them simpler to cleanse, assisting stop dental cavity or dental caries It's typically a dental expert that initially notifications misaligned teeth throughout a routine exam.
